I, too, would look to El Salvador as an example because of their bitcoin
experience.

And the apparently utter disaster it has been, largely due to a failure to
win the trust of the general public.

This suggests that, until and unless (emphasis on "and unless") those who
propose these schemes include workable ways to get the public to accept
them, they will - or at least their practical effects will - be postponed
indefinitely.

Now, can anyone predict when those who propose such schemes will include
workable ways to get the public to trust them?  In theory that could happen
today...or it could have happened at any time in the past decade, but
apparently has not, which fails to suggest a reasonable upper limit for how
long it will take.  "Anywhen from now until forever" is not a usefully
narrow time range.
